Discount Rate
Within discounted cash flow analysis, it is the interest rate used to determine the present value of cash flows anticipated in the future.
Initial Investment
Initial Investment is the amount of money used to start a project, purchase an asset, or invest in a financial product, prior to generating any returns.
Cash Inflows
This term describes the movement of money into a business or entity, typically from operations, investments, or financing activities.
Average Accounting Return (AAR)
A financial ratio that represents the average net income divided by the average book value of the investment over its life, typically used in capital budgeting.
